A Southampton Sex Offender, Sean Raven, who sexually attacked a woman and pilfered her pants has evaded incarceration.
Sean Raven, 26, “violated” his victim’s body, the woman said, and made “lewd” comments towards her.
Sean Raven touched her inappropriately over her clothing which made her feel “shocked and uncomfortable”.
In a separate incident, he said to her: “I want to see what underwear you are wearing.”
Sean Raven was handed a two-year community order and must complete up to 45 rehabilitation activity requirements and 100 hours of unpaid work.
